Class DataCharacteristicReferenceItemProvider
java.lang.Object
org.eclipse.emf.common.notify.impl.AdapterImpl
org.eclipse.emf.edit.provider.ItemProviderAdapter
de.uka.ipd.sdq.identifier.provider.IdentifierItemProvider
org.palladiosimulator.dataflow.dictionary.characterized.DataDictionaryCharacterized.expressions.provider.TermItemProvider
org.palladiosimulator.dataflow.dictionary.characterized.DataDictionaryCharacterized.expressions.provider.CharacteristicReferenceItemProvider
org.palladiosimulator.dataflow.dictionary.characterized.DataDictionaryCharacterized.expressions.provider.EnumCharacteristicReferenceItemProvider
org.palladiosimulator.dataflow.dictionary.characterized.DataDictionaryCharacterized.expressions.provider.DataCharacteristicReferenceItemProviderGen
org.palladiosimulator.dataflow.dictionary.characterized.DataDictionaryCharacterized.expressions.provider.DataCharacteristicReferenceItemProvider
- All Implemented Interfaces:
Adapter,Adapter.Internal,ResourceLocator,CreateChildCommand.Helper,IChangeNotifier,IDisposable,IEditingDomainItemProvider,IItemLabelProvider,IItemPropertySource,IStructuredItemContentProvider,ITreeItemContentProvider
public class DataCharacteristicReferenceItemProvider
extends DataCharacteristicReferenceItemProviderGen
-
Nested Class Summary
Nested classes/interfaces inherited from class org.eclipse.emf.edit.provider.ItemProviderAdapter
ItemProviderAdapter.ChildrenStore, ItemProviderAdapter.ModifiableSingletonEList<E extends Object>, ItemProviderAdapter.ResultAndAffectedObjectsWrappingCommand, ItemProviderAdapter.ResultAndAffectedObjectsWrappingCommandActionDelegateNested classes/interfaces inherited from interface org.eclipse.emf.common.notify.Adapter
Adapter.Internal -
Field Summary
Fields inherited from class org.eclipse.emf.edit.provider.ItemProviderAdapter
adapterFactory, changeNotifier, childrenFeatures, childrenReferences, childrenStoreMap, itemPropertyDescriptors, targets, wrappers, wrappingNeededFields inherited from class org.eclipse.emf.common.notify.impl.AdapterImpl
target -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ected voidaddLiteralPropertyDescriptor(Object object) This adds a property descriptor for the Literal feature.protected voidaddPinPropertyDescriptor(Object object) This adds a property descriptor for the Pin feature.protected static <T> TgetLastParentOfType(EObject object, Class<T> parentClass) protected static <T> TgetParentOfType(EObject object, Class<T> parentClass) Methods inherited from class org.palladiosimulator.dataflow.dictionary.characterized.DataDictionaryCharacterized.expressions.provider.DataCharacteristicReferenceItemProviderGen
collectNewChildDescriptors, getImage, getPropertyDescriptors, getText, notifyChangedMethods inherited from class org.palladiosimulator.dataflow.dictionary.characterized.DataDictionaryCharacterized.expressions.provider.CharacteristicReferenceItemProvider
addCharacteristicTypePropertyDescriptorMethods inherited from class org.palladiosimulator.dataflow.dictionary.characterized.DataDictionaryCharacterized.expressions.provider.TermItemProvider
getResourceLocatorMethods inherited from class de.uka.ipd.sdq.identifier.provider.IdentifierItemProvider
addIdPropertyDescriptorMethods inherited from class org.eclipse.emf.edit.provider.ItemProviderAdapter
addListener, adjustWrapperIndex, adjustWrapperIndices, adjustWrapperIndices, createAddCommand, createAddCommand, createChildParameter, createChildrenStore, createCommand, createCopyCommand, createCreateChildCommand, createCreateChildCommand, createCreateCopyCommand, createDragAndDropCommand, createDragAndDropCommand, createInitializeCopyCommand, createItemPropertyDescriptor, createItemPropertyDescriptor, createItemPropertyDescriptor, createMoveCommand, createMoveCommand, createRemoveCommand, createRemoveCommand, createReplaceCommand, createReplaceCommand, createReplaceCommand, createSetCommand, createSetCommand, createWrapper, crop, dispose, disposeWrapper, disposeWrappers, factorAddCommand, factorMoveCommand, factorRemoveCommand, fireNotifyChanged, getAdapterFactory, getBackground, getBackground, getBaseURL, getChildFeature, getChildReference, getChildren, getChildrenFeatures, getChildrenReferences, getChildrenStore, getColumnImage, getColumnText, getCreateChildDescription, getCreateChildImage, getCreateChildResult, getCreateChildText, getCreateChildToolTipText, getEditableValue, getElements, getFeatureText, getFeatureValue, getFont, getFont, getForeground, getForeground, getImage, getNewChildDescriptors, getParent, getPropertyDescriptor, getPropertyValue, getReferenceValue, getResourceLocator, getRootAdapterFactory, getSetFeature, getSetFeatures, getString, getString, getString, getString, getString, getString, getString, getString, getStyledText, getTypeText, getTypeText, getUpdateableText, getValue, getWrappedValues, hasChildren, hasChildren, isAdapterForType, isEquivalentValue, isPropertySet, isResolveProxies, isValidValue, isWrappingNeeded, overlayImage, removeListener, resetPropertyValue, setPropertyValue, setTarget, shouldComposeCreationImage, shouldTranslate, unsetTarget, unwrap, unwrapCommandValues, updateChildren, wrap, wrapCommandMethods inherited from class org.eclipse.emf.common.notify.impl.AdapterImpl
getTargetM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face org.eclipse.emf.edit.provider.IEditingDomainItemProvider
createCommand, getChildren, getNewChildDescriptors, getParentMethods inherited from interface org.eclipse.emf.edit.provider.IItemPropertySource
getEditableValue, getPropertyDescriptorMethods inherited from interface org.eclipse.emf.edit.provider.IStructuredItemContentProvider
getElementsMethods inherited from interface org.eclipse.emf.edit.provider.ITreeItemContentProvider
getChildren, getParent, hasChildren
-
Constructor Details
-
DataCharacteristicReferenceItemProvider
-
-
Method Details
-
addPinPropertyDescriptor
Description copied from class:DataCharacteristicReferenceItemProviderGenThis adds a property descriptor for the Pin feature.- Overrides:
addPinPropertyDescriptorin classDataCharacteristicReferenceItemProviderGen
-
addLiteralPropertyDescriptor
Description copied from class:EnumCharacteristicReferenceItemProviderThis adds a property descriptor for the Literal feature.- Overrides:
addLiteralPropertyDescriptorin classEnumCharacteristicReferenceItemProvider
-
getLastParentOfType
-
getParentOfType
-